Best Gutter Installation & Repair Services for Manchester Homes

Protect your home from water damage by choosing gutter installers who assess roof lines, downspouts, and drainage paths before recommending solutions.

You’ll want teams that offer custom-fit seamless gutters to reduce leaks and debris buildup, and they should explain material options and color matches for your home.

During installation, expect clear timelines, proper hangers, and tested downspout placement to channel water away from foundations.

For repairs, pick contractors who diagnose sagging, pinholes, or improper slope and fix flashing or fasteners promptly.

Ask about scheduled seasonal maintenance plans so you’re not surprised by clogs or ice dams.

Reliable providers will give written estimates, local references, and work warranties to protect your investment.

How Long Is the Warranty on Both Roofing and Gutter Installations?

Warranty duration usually ranges from 5 to 25 years, and sometimes you’ll get a lifetime option for certain materials; labor coverage often runs separately for 1 to 10 years.

You should ask contractors for written details on both manufacturer and installer warranties, confirm what’s covered (materials, labor, leaks, workmanship), and get exclusions in writing so you won’t be surprised if repairs aren’t fully paid under the policy.

Can Contractors Match or Replace Historical Roofing Materials on Older Homes?

Yes — you can have contractors match or replace historical roofing materials on older homes. You’ll find pros who specialize in matching slate, fabricating custom cedar, and sourcing reclaimed or reproduction materials to preserve your home’s character.

You’ll want to ask about their experience with period homes, see examples, confirm material sourcing, and get a detailed plan and warranty.

Expect slightly higher costs and longer timelines for authentic restoration work.
